Late President Buhari left Nigeria’s economy flourishing – Former Aviation Minister, Hadi Sirika

Former Minister of Aviation, Hadi Sirika, has claimed that late President Muhammadu Buhari left the economy flourishing when he left office in May 2023.

 

 

 

Sirika said this when he appeared on Arise TV today, July 13.

 

‘’President Buhari had done extremely well on the economy. I am not an economist, but I do know so because I have been in the country and also been in the government. I have seen that the country at the time was in a much better state at the time, both in terms of the economy and the education sector.

 

I believe President Buhari left behind a country that was flourishing. However, I’m neither President Buhari nor President Tinubu, so I cannot fully comment on the policies they made or the decisions they took while in office. I don’t think it would be fair for me to sit here and criticize policies” he said

 

Late Buhari served as the President of Nigeria from May 29, 2015, to May 29, 2023. He passed away on July 13, 2025.
